A quick reccie session in the evening before going off to check in at the campsite (Pwylln farm btw, & can highly recommend!) and wanted to check out the stretch I hadnt fished before above the old farmhouse and up to the waterfall boundary.
Low water for sure and generally a bit of a bedrock shute for a short way but the waterfall area is lovely in all ways .
Didnt move any fish to a search dry but sure there must be some here somewhere!
The back of the famhouse has a deepish but reasonably slow gutter . Could fish well at the right time?
Access along the bank/river was fine.

Very disappointed with the upstream section of this beat. Access to the river was totally obstructed by vegetation with no clearing to have been done. This in addition to near vertical banks made getting down to the water extremely difficult. I do think that the land owners do hold some responsibility to make sure their fishery has reasonable access considering the price for a days fishing.
The river was very low of course and only managed to catch a couple of small chub with no sign of barbel...both were caught on small cubes of bacon grill on swim feeder tactics.
The downstream of the beat may have better access but based on what the upper beat was like I personally could not recommend this particular fishery.
